Output 24918aefbcd86b173d7c2f982dbcc1f91e621b5523d649882370481de2958663:6

value
31900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6251fa3b9105d4140b9a2004b1e1df77eaab49d2 OP_EQUAL
address
3AetMEjteCzWoE4kfxmB2gv5UZ2xJ4ug7w
transaction
24918aefbcd86b173d7c2f982dbcc1f91e621b5523d649882370481de2958663
spent
true